Historical Background of Police Corruption in Baltimore

To fully understand the issue of Baltimore corrupt cops, it is essential to examine the historical context of police corruption in the city. Corruption in law enforcement is often rooted in systemic issues that have developed over decades. In Baltimore, various factors have contributed to a culture of corruption, including:

  • Lack of oversight and accountability within the police department.
  • High levels of crime and poverty, leading to desperation among some officers.
  • Political influences that may shield corrupt officers from consequences.

Historically, Baltimore has experienced several high-profile corruption cases. For instance, the 2010 case involving the Gun Trace Task Force (GTTF) highlighted the extent of corruption within the BPD. Officers were found to be stealing drugs, money, and firearms, further exacerbating the community's distrust in law enforcement.

Noteworthy Cases of Corruption

Several cases of police corruption have stood out in Baltimore's recent history. These cases serve as stark reminders of the challenges faced by the BPD and the impact of corruption on community relations. Some of the most significant cases include:

1. Gun Trace Task Force Scandal

The Gun Trace Task Force scandal was a pivotal moment in the fight against police corruption in Baltimore. Officers were implicated in various illegal activities, including:

  • Stealing drugs and money from suspects.
  • Planting evidence to justify arrests.
  • Using police resources for personal gain.

This scandal led to numerous arrests and convictions of officers involved, shining a light on the need for systemic reform within the department.

2. The Death of Freddie Gray

The death of Freddie Gray in 2015 sparked widespread protests and brought attention to police practices in Baltimore. While not a direct case of corruption, it highlighted issues of police brutality and the urgent need for accountability. The fallout from Gray's death led to a federal investigation and ongoing discussions about police reform.

3. The Case of Officer William Porter

Officer William Porter was charged in connection with Gray's death, and his trial drew significant media attention. The case underscored the complexities of prosecuting police officers and the challenges faced in seeking justice within a flawed system.

Reform Efforts and Initiatives

In response to the ongoing issues of corruption and misconduct, various reform efforts have been implemented to address these challenges. Some of the key initiatives include:

  • Establishment of the Baltimore Police Department's Consent Decree, which mandates reforms aimed at increasing transparency and accountability.
  • Implementation of body-worn cameras for officers to ensure accountability during interactions with the public.
  • Increased community engagement programs to rebuild trust and improve relationships between police and residents.

These efforts represent a step in the right direction, but there is still much work to be done to restore faith in law enforcement.
